Daka, March 25, Bangladesh said on Tuesday that it is awaiting India’s response to India’s decision between the chief adviser Mohamed Younis and Prime Minister Narendra Modi during Bimstec (Baystec) in BIMSTEC (Bay Bay Multi-Multial Technical) next week.
In a press conference here, the Minister of Foreign Affairs of Bangladesh, Mohamed Jashim Odeen, described the upcoming visa Younes to China and Thailand, saying: “We are completely ready to meet on our behalf. Now we are waiting for a positive response from India.
Earlier, Dhaka sent a message to India and suggested a meeting between Yunus and Moody. Moody and Yionus can visit Thailand to attend the Bimstec summit. Bangladesh has proposed a meeting of the two leaders on the sidelines of the program.

Last week, Foreign Ministry spokesman Ranhair Jaiswal said he had no updated information about any planned meeting between the two leaders.
Yunus will be in Bangkok to attend the Bimstec summit on April 2-4.
Before Bangkok’s visit, Yunus will go to China on a three -day visit starting on Wednesday, where they will attend the BFA annual conference in Hanan Province, a commercial summit like the World Economic Forum in Switzerland.
The Ministry of Foreign Affairs in Bangladesh said that Yunus will hold a bilateral meeting with Chinese President Xi Jinping during its visit, during which it can discuss the issue of the Testa River reservoir across the border.
Earlier, India expressed its objections to Chinese participation in the project during the rule of Al -Hasinah.

Jashim Odeen said that the internal state of Minanma and the Rohingya case will be discussed during Yunus’s visit to China. He said that both sides are expected to sign agreements on human resource development, economic and technical cooperation and media communication.
